Ways to Fix the Windows Blue Screen Errors?
There are various ways to fix the Windows Blue Screen errors. Here we have explained few of them in details. Follow them and get rid of the error as soon as possible:
Update the Drivers of Computer
Outdated drivers can be the reason behind the blue screen error. We always advised keeping your computer drivers up to date so that you don’t have to come across any uncertain windows errors. To check if you have any pending updates then navigate to:
Firstly go to Settings.
Then Update and Security
Lastly Windows update
If there are any pending updates then you will find them in the above steps. See the drivers by right-clicking on the Windows start menu. This will open the power user menu and when it does select the Device Manager. Look at your computer’s drivers, If you any yellow triangle next to your drivers then it means that are outdated. Uninstall Apps in your Computer
Another possible reason that causes blue screen error to appear in the recent apps that you have installed is not playing okay with your computer. Try and remember the last few apps you have installed before getting the blue screen error. Uninstall those apps by following the steps:
First of all, go to Settings
Then go to Apps and features
After that click on the app, you want to uninstall
Next click on the Uninstall button
Disconnect the Connected Device
In case you got the blue screen right after you connected a new device, by disconnecting the device you can eliminate the error. The reason behind this, the new device’s software is not compatible with your PC.
